6/10 I was hoping that after I read another not so good realistic book I would enjoy this one however I did not enjoy this one that much since I found issues with this and I would not pick this one up again, where do I even begin. It started off with the main character known as Josephine Beckett otherwise known as Jo who's a wrestler who wants to overcome the label of "practice girl" but then it dragged and turned into a friendship and love story. I liked how at the beginning there was a definition of the titular word which is something mature. There was a random scene where Jo partied, and danced in the town hall and I'm not sure this is necessary to the plot especially considering how it changed halfway through. By the way the main character was such a narcissist since she insulted her friends and claimed to be better than she was (that she wouldn't be used as a practice girl anymore), but she was still the same person when she hooked up with Dax, at least she developed her character in the end ending this in a high note.… (plus d'informations)
